Sortera Group Acquires Big Bag Sweden AB

On June 12, 2017, Sortera Group acquired environmental company Big Bag Sweden AB from Fagerberg & Dellby

DESCRIPTION

Sortera Group is a niche operator in the waste management sector. Sortera’s main offering is heavy duty builder bags in which building material waste can be placed unsorted or sorted. Containers are also offered as an alternative or supplement to the bags. Sortera Group was founded in 2006 and is based in Stockholm, Sweden.

DESCRIPTION

Fagerberg & Dellby is a Swedish investment firm focused on family-owned businesses facing a 'generational shift' or in need of new ownership to help speed up development. The Firm looks to help transition family-owned businesses to successful standalone entities. F&D targets businesses generating 200 to 600 MSEK of revenue. Fagerberg & Dellby was formed in 2008 and is based in Stockholm.
